1994 Changes

I was reading on ConsumerGuide (lol) about 2nd gens and I noticed something about the 1994:

"The big news for 1994 is the arrival of 4-wheel antilock brakes. The new system is only available on 4Runners with the V6. It replaces the previous rear-wheels-only system that had been in place since 1990. All 4Runners now provide a center high-mounted stoplight and side door guard beams."

That sucks. I'd love front ABS. I had no idea it was available on the 94s. Where does this system go? Assuming by the airbox?

Has anyone swapped this system over before? I'm guessing I'd need whatever actuator and the speed sensors.


I love the inclusion of the side door beams. LMAO that is the least worry when getting hit in a 2nd gen.
